Tennessee -9 over Vanderbilt. I will post more info on this game as the week goes on. Bottom line is Vanderbilt is horrible. Tennessee just hung 50+ points on Ol Miss and Memphis in back to back games. I know neither one is Ohio State but never the less 50 points is 50 points. I think Derek Dooley finally has himself a QB in Tyler Bray a freshman. In the last 2 games he has thrown for 648 yards, 8 TDs and no turnovers. Vandy's passing defense is ranked 95th out of 120 schools.
Vanderbilt's QB on the other hand is Larry Smith, who may be the worse D1 QB in the country. Vandy is averaging 18 points per game with him under center. For his career at Vandy which covers 3 years and 480 passes he has a completion % of 48% with 11 TDs and 12 INTs and 2500 yards. His running skills are no better. For his career he has 479 yards in 196 carries for an average of 2.4 yds per carry. Honestly I have no idea why he is their QB.
Here is the final kicker. Tennessee is 4-6 with 2 games left. Despite stinking most of the year they still have a shot to go to a bowl but they need a win against Vandy and a win at home next week against Kentucky. Both are very winnable games. The game is at Vandy but since both schools are in Tennessee there should be a good contingent of Tennessee fans in attendance. Wil update the thread as the week goes on.
